Which molecule would you expect to be a free radical? which molecule would you expect to be a free radical? co co2 n2o no2?
DanielleElmas [232]
<span>No2 would be the free radical as it has an unpaired electron in it's grouping. Since free radicals are defined by the attribute of having an unpaired electron in their make-up, no2 fits this definition.</span>
